Python项目开发学习资料汇总

需积分: 4 0 下载量 112 浏览量 更新于2024-10-11 收藏 98.08MB ZIP 举报
资源摘要信息:"这些是用Python编写的一些简单的项目。" 在这份文件信息中,我们可以提取到几个关键知识点和资源分类。以下是对文件标题、描述和标签的详细解释: 1. 文件标题:"这些是用Python编写的一些简单的项目。.zip" - 标题中提到的“Python编写”和“简单的项目”暗示了该压缩包内包含了多个使用Python语言实现的小型或初学者级别的项目代码。 - 文件扩展名“.zip”表明这是一个压缩文件,需要使用解压缩工具来打开和访问其中的内容。 2. 文件描述: - 描述部分详细列举了多种软件开发设计相关的技术领域,包括应用软件开发、系统软件开发、移动应用开发和网站开发。Python作为描述中提及的编程语言之一,通常被用于这些开发领域,特别是对于初学者和快速原型开发非常友好。 - 硬件与设备方面,虽然文件描述没有直接提到Python在这些领域的应用,但Python社区提供了许多针对单片机编程、EDA(电子设计自动化)、Proteus(模拟软件)、RTOS(实时操作系统)以及各类硬件开发的库和工具,使开发者能够使用Python进行这些硬件相关的项目开发。 - 操作系统部分,描述中提到Linux、树莓派、安卓开发等。Python对于Linux系统友好,并广泛应用于树莓派项目和安卓应用开发,特别是在需要快速原型开发和脚本自动化时。 - 网络与通信是一个跨学科的领域,Python提供了大量的网络编程库,如socket编程,以及对信号处理、网络协议分析的高级库,这使得Python成为网络与通信领域开发的首选语言之一。 - 云计算与大数据部分,Python在这一领域同样大放异彩,尤其是在使用云计算平台、大数据分析、人工智能和机器学习等技术时,Python提供了强大的库如TensorFlow、Keras、PyTorch等,支持复杂的数据处理和算法实现。 3. 文件标签:"python 脚本 毕业设计 课程设计 项目开发" - 标签中的“python”直接点明了该资源的主要编程语言。 - “脚本”表明资源中可能包含的是用于特定任务执行的脚本程序,通常这类程序简洁、功能单一且易于编写和理解。 - “毕业设计”和“课程设计”说明了这些项目可能是在学术环境下为学生提供实践操作的材料,用于帮助学生完成学业要求。 - “项目开发”表明这些Python项目不仅限于学术用途,也适合进行实际的项目开发练习,帮助开发者建立项目开发经验。 由于压缩包文件的文件名称列表只提供了一个数字"222",这显然是不完整的,也没有提供关于文件内容的任何具体信息。因此无法基于此信息提取额外的知识点。 综上所述,这份文件提供了与Python项目开发相关的一系列知识点和资源概览。通过以上详细的解析,我们可以了解到Python语言在不同技术领域内的应用及其在开发实践中的价值。